MEMO — Sales Leads, Fennick & Vale

The pilot with the Cobbleworth retail chain begins next month across six stores in the Dresmere region. Scope: shelf analytics via our Larkspur platform, eight-week term, success measured on restock accuracy and staff adoption. Do not discuss terms with other retail prospects until the pilot concludes. Weekly readouts go to the pilot committee only. The wider intent is captured in the note below.

confidential, kagup-bafog: Fraaxax Group is in early talks to buy Soroxox Group for about $343.8 million. The Olidor launch date is June 14, and nothing goes to the press before then. Legal wants the Aldmirek Logistics term sheet signed before July 23.

## Configuration

Nightfill runs backfill jobs on a cron-style schedule defined in `schedule.toml`. Each job declares a source table, a target window, and a concurrency cap. Maintainers should keep the default window at 24 hours unless a replay is explicitly requested. The scheduler authenticates to the Corvid warehouse using a token read from the environment. Set it in the env file on the line below:

vault entry, yahif-yajep: COURIER_KEY29=b802bdf8034096b65a51c6ba5abe2

## Who to ping about GiftNote

Welcome aboard! GiftNote is our donation-receipt mailer for the Larchfield Fund. Template tweaks go to the comms folks; delivery failures and bounce weirdness go to the platform crew. Don't push template changes on Fridays — receipts batch over the weekend. For anything GiftNote-related, start with the address below.

billing contact of kaweg-tajeg = drudor.lamion.oliath@torvalabs.test